Sure! Let's break down the problem into three parts: input, processing, and output.

1. Input:
To receive an integer from the screen, you need to prompt the user to enter a number. You can use the built-in input() function to achieve this. Here's an example:

```
num = int(input("Enter an integer: "))
```

2. Processing:
The algorithm requires three mathematical operations: adding 5, doubling the number, and subtracting 7. You can perform these operations sequentially. Here's the algorithm in pseudocode:

```
num = num + 5
num = num * 2
num = num - 7
```

3. Output:
To display the final number on the screen, you can use the print() function. Here's an example:

```
print("The final number is: ", num)
```

Putting everything together, here's the solution algorithm:

```
1. Prompt the user to enter an integer.
2. Read the input and store it in a variable called "num".
3. Perform the following operations sequentially:
- num = num + 5
- num = num * 2
- num = num - 7
4. Display the final number on the screen using the print() function.
```

To solve this problem, you will need to follow these steps:

1. Input: You need to prompt the user to enter an integer from the screen. You can do this by using a programming language and its input functions, for example, using the `input()` function in Python or `Scanner` class in Java to receive user input.

2. Processing: Once you have received the input, you need to use the provided algorithm to perform the necessary calculations. Here's the algorithm:

a. Add 5 to the input integer.
b. Double the result obtained in step a.
c. Subtract 7 from the doubled result.

Let's say the input integer is stored in a variable called `inputNum`. You can write the code as follows in Python:

```python
inputNum = int(input("Enter an integer: "))
result = ((inputNum + 5) * 2) - 7
```

Or as follows in Java:

```java
import java.util.Scanner;

public class Main {
public static void main(String[] args) {
Scanner scanner = new Scanner(System.in);
System.out.print("Enter an integer: ");
int inputNum = scanner.nextInt();
int result = ((inputNum + 5) * 2) - 7;
scanner.close();
}
}
```

3. Output: Finally, to display the result on the screen, you need to use an output function in your chosen programming language. For example, using `print()` function in Python or `System.out.println()` in Java.

If you are using Python, you can add the following line of code to display the result:

```python
print("Final number:", result)
```

If you are using Java, add the following line of code:

```java
System.out.println("Final number: " + result);
```

With these steps, you now have an algorithm that receives an integer from the screen, adds 5 to it, doubles it, subtracts 7 from it, and displays the final number on the screen.
